diff options
author | Matt Johnston <matt@ucc.asn.au> | 2009-07-30 15:14:33 +0000 |
---|---|---|
committer | Matt Johnston <matt@ucc.asn.au> | 2009-07-30 15:14:33 +0000 |
commit | 416a2bf4a43576bb0f16f36a72b12359836cf2f3 (patch) | |
tree | 8860f704799ceb21d00a5ee830f94d1a7117e74e /agentfwd.h | |
parent | 89719900644be0773806a1ca9f4c3766d5333f7f (diff) | |
download | dropbear-416a2bf4a43576bb0f16f36a72b12359836cf2f3.tar.gz |
Agent forwarding worksagent-client
Diffstat (limited to 'agentfwd.h')
-rw-r--r-- | agentfwd.h | 10 |
1 files changed, 6 insertions, 4 deletions
@@ -35,14 +35,16 @@ * 10000 is arbitrary */ #define MAX_AGENT_REPLY 10000 -int agentreq(struct ChanSess * chansess); -void agentcleanup(struct ChanSess * chansess); -void agentset(struct ChanSess *chansess); +int svr_agentreq(struct ChanSess * chansess); +void svr_agentcleanup(struct ChanSess * chansess); +void svr_agentset(struct ChanSess *chansess); /* client functions */ -void load_agent_keys(m_list * ret_list); +void cli_load_agent_keys(m_list * ret_list); void agent_buf_sign(buffer *sigblob, sign_key *key, const unsigned char *data, unsigned int len); +void cli_setup_agent(struct Channel *channel); + #ifdef __hpux #define seteuid(a) setresuid(-1, (a), -1) |